Transport & Amenities
Forfar is a vibrant town with all amenities you need close to hand, with leading supermarkets, restaurants, bars, primary schools, recently built secondary school with adjoining sports centre, golf club, walks round Forfar Loch and Rescobie Loch, medical centres and a hospital. Forfar have a monthly farmers market throughout the year. Other places of interest in Forfar are the Meffan Gallery and Museum, Merton Farm nature reserve and just 15 minutes by car to Glamis Castle.
A great commuter’s town, this property is within easy reach to the A90 Aberdeen/Dundee dual carriageway. Aberdeen is just 55-minutes’ drive and has a range of shopping opportunities and Aberdeen airport just beyond. Dundee 30 minutes away for all major shops, universities and train stations. The other local towns of Montrose and Arbroath are approximately 20 minutes driving distance.
